Banks
Major Banks and Competitive Rates: If you have a bank account with a major bank like HSBC, Barclays, or Lloyds, it is often the best option for exchange rates. These banks typically offer competitive exchange rates and lower fees, especially if you have an account with them. For long-term travelers or those who frequently travel to London, maintaining a bank account in the UK can also be beneficial as it often provides more flexibility and lower transaction fees.

Post Offices
Competitive Rates and No Commission Fees: The Post Office is another reliable option for currency exchange. They offer competitive rates and no commission fees, making them a cost-effective choice for travelers. Whether you need to exchange a large amount or a small sum, the Post Office is a safe and convenient option. It is particularly useful for those who are cautious about the fees associated with exchange services.
